Biography: The Story of Traci Lords
Traci Elizabeth Lords, born Nora Louise Kuzma, entered the world on May 7, 1968. Her birthplace was Steubenville, Ohio, which is, you know, where her story really begins. She is an American actress and singer, and her career has certainly seen many interesting turns over the years.
At a very young age, Traci Lords, then Nora Kuzma, found herself amid scandal. This period, in fact, brought her international fame, though perhaps not in the way one might expect. She became known for appearing in certain films at the age of 15, using, you know, a fake birth certificate to do so. Personal Details & Bio Data
Full Name: | Nora Louise Kuzma |
Known As: | Traci Elizabeth Lords, Traci Lords |
Born: | May 7, 1968 |
Birthplace: | Steubenville, Ohio, United States |
Occupation: | Actress, Singer, Writer, Director, Producer, Voiceover Artist |
Notable TV Series: | MacGyver, Married… with Children, Melrose Place, Profiler |
Stage Debut: | Gloria in "Women Behind Bars" (2020) |

Stage Debut and Recent Work
In recent years, Traci Lords has continued to, you know, explore new creative avenues, showing her ongoing commitment to her craft. A significant development in her career was her stage debut in 2020. This was, in fact, a fresh challenge for her, quite publicly.
She took on the role of Gloria in the revival of Tom Eyen's cult classic "Women Behind Bars."
